The S&P 500 rose 0.58% to 7563.63, driven by strength in Healthcare and Technology, while Utilities and Energy lagged. The Nasdaq outperformed with a 0.91% gain, and the Dow Jones added only 0.05%. The VIX settled at 15.8, reflecting moderately low market anxiety.

The top-performing sectors were Healthcare (+1.4%) and Technology (+1.3%). Healthcare’s advance may have been fueled by positive earnings reports or defensive rotation amid lingering economic uncertainty, while Technology likely benefited from continued investor appetite for growth stocks and artificial intelligence themes. Consumer Discretionary (+0.4%), Materials (+0.3%), and Communication Services (+0.3%) also posted modest gains, suggesting selective bullish sentiment. On the downside, Utilities (-1.1%) was the worst performer, possibly due to rising bond yields or profit-taking after recent gains, as higher interest rates diminish the appeal of yield-oriented sectors. Real Estate (-0.5%) also weakened for similar reasons. Financials (-0.3%) and Industrials (-0.3%) slipped, likely reflecting mixed economic signals and uncertainty about the pace of future rate cuts. Consumer Staples (-0.2%) and Energy (-0.1%) edged lower, with Energy pressured by mild oil price weakness and subdued global demand expectations. The sector dispersion underscores a risk-on tilt toward growth areas, while defensive and rate-sensitive sectors faced headwinds. The S&P 500’s close at 7563.63 places it above its 50-day moving average (which is estimated near 7500 based on recent action), suggesting short-term bullish momentum. The index is also approaching its 200-day moving average, currently around 7600, which may act as a key resistance level. A break above that threshold could open the door to further gains, while support is likely near the 7500 round number and the 50-day average. Market breadth was mixed: advancing stocks outnumbered decliners on the Nasdaq, but the Dow’s meager 0.05% gain indicates narrower participation. The VIX at 15.8 remains in the low range, well below the historical average of about 20, signaling subdued fear. This reading typically aligns with a calm but slightly optimistic market environment, though it may also warn of complacency. A VIX below 17 often accompanies steady uptrends, but any spike above 20 could trigger hedging activity. Looking ahead, investors will focus on upcoming economic data releases, including the latest Consumer Price Index (CPI) and Producer Price Index (PPI) reports, which could influence Federal Reserve policy expectations. Additionally, minutes from the Fed’s most recent meeting may provide clues on the timing of rate cuts. Upbeat inflation figures might reinforce the case for a prolonged hold, potentially pressuring rate-sensitive sectors like Real Estate and Utilities. On the earnings front, major tech and healthcare companies are reporting this week, and strong results could sustain the rally in Technology and Healthcare. Conversely, disappointing guidance might trigger profit-taking. An escalation in trade or geopolitical tensions could dampen risk appetite, while a dovish Fed or dovish comments from officials could boost cyclical sectors. The interplay of these factors may determine whether the S&P 500 can hold above 7500 and challenge the 7600 resistance level.
